Building a website is a complex task that requires a blend of creativity, technical skills, and strategic thinking. Whether you are a beginner or an experienced web developer, leveraging advanced ChatGPT prompts can significantly enhance your workflow and the quality of your output. Advanced prompts, including nested prompts, allow you to dive deeper into the capabilities of ChatGPT, enabling you to generate more sophisticated content, design elements, and code that align perfectly with your website’s goals.
This comprehensive guide will explore how to use advanced ChatGPT prompts and nested prompts to build a website. We will delve into how these techniques can help you create more effective and precise content, streamline your development process, and optimize your website for better performance and user experience. By the end of this article, you’ll be equipped with the knowledge and tools to use ChatGPT to its fullest potential, ensuring your website stands out in the crowded digital landscape.
The Power of Advanced and Nested Prompts
Before we dive into specific examples, it’s important to understand what advanced and nested prompts are and why they are crucial for sophisticated tasks like website building.
What Are Advanced Prompts?
Advanced prompts are more complex and detailed than basic prompts. They involve providing specific instructions, constraints, and context to guide ChatGPT’s responses. This level of specificity helps the AI generate output that is closer to what you need, reducing the amount of post-generation editing and refinement required.
- Specific Instructions: Advanced prompts include clear, specific instructions that tell ChatGPT exactly what you want. For example, instead of asking for a generic blog post, you might ask for a blog post with a specific structure, tone, and target audience.
- Contextual Information: Providing context within your prompts helps ChatGPT understand the bigger picture, leading to more relevant and accurate responses. For example, if you’re asking for a product description, providing details about the target market and product features can lead to a more compelling description.
What Are Nested Prompts?
Nested prompts are a more intricate form of prompting where multiple layers of instructions are embedded within a single prompt. This technique allows you to break down complex tasks into manageable parts and guide ChatGPT through each step sequentially.
- Layered Instructions: Nested prompts involve breaking down a task into smaller, nested components. For example, you might first ask ChatGPT to generate an outline for a blog post, then use a second prompt to expand on each section of the outline.
- Sequential Workflow: Nested prompts can be used to create a step-by-step workflow, where each subsequent prompt builds on the output of the previous one. This approach is particularly useful for complex projects like website building, where multiple interconnected elements need to be developed.
Why Use Advanced and Nested Prompts for Website Building?
Using advanced and nested prompts for website building offers several key advantages:
- Precision and Accuracy: By providing detailed instructions, you can guide ChatGPT to generate content and code that closely aligns with your vision, reducing the need for extensive revisions.
- Efficiency and Workflow Optimization: Nested prompts allow you to break down complex tasks into smaller steps, streamlining your workflow and making it easier to manage large projects.
- Enhanced Creativity: Advanced prompts can help you explore creative possibilities that you might not have considered, leading to innovative design and content ideas.
- Comprehensive Output: By layering prompts, you can ensure that all aspects of a task are covered thoroughly, resulting in a more comprehensive and polished final product.
Crafting Advanced Prompts for Website Content Creation
Content creation is a critical aspect of website building, and advanced prompts can help you generate high-quality, targeted content that engages your audience and improves your site’s SEO performance.
Example 1: Advanced Blog Post Prompts
When creating blog posts, it’s important to consider the structure, tone, and target audience. Here’s how you can use advanced prompts to generate a well-structured and engaging blog post.
Step 1: Define the Purpose and Audience
- Prompt: “I need a 1,500-word blog post about the benefits of remote work for small businesses. The target audience is small business owners who are considering allowing their employees to work remotely. The tone should be informative yet persuasive.”
Step 2: Request an Outline
- Prompt: “Provide a detailed outline for this blog post. The outline should include an introduction, three main sections (each with two subpoints), and a conclusion that offers actionable tips.”
Step 3: Expand on Each Section
- Prompt: “Expand on the first section of the outline, which discusses the cost-saving benefits of remote work. Include data and statistics to support the argument, and explain how these savings can be reinvested into business growth.”
Step 4: Optimize for SEO
- Prompt: “Rewrite the introduction and the first section to include the following SEO keywords: ‘remote work cost savings,’ ‘small business remote work benefits,’ and ‘reduce overhead costs with remote work.’ Ensure the text reads naturally and maintains a persuasive tone.”
This layered approach ensures that the final blog post is well-organized, informative, and optimized for search engines, making it more likely to engage readers and rank well in search results.
Example 2: Advanced Product Descriptions
Product descriptions are crucial for e-commerce websites, as they influence purchasing decisions. Here’s how you can craft advanced prompts to create compelling and persuasive product descriptions.
Step 1: Describe the Product
- Prompt: “Write a product description for a luxury leather backpack. The backpack is made from full-grain leather, has a minimalist design, and features multiple compartments for organization. It’s targeted at professionals who need a stylish yet functional bag for work and travel.”
Step 2: Highlight Unique Selling Points
- Prompt: “In the product description, emphasize the unique selling points, such as the durability of full-grain leather, the sleek and professional design, and the practicality of the compartments. Include a statement about the craftsmanship and attention to detail.”
Step 3: Address Customer Pain Points
- Prompt: “Address potential customer pain points, such as concerns about weight, maintenance of leather, and whether the backpack is suitable for both work and casual settings. Provide reassurance and solutions, such as lightweight construction and easy-to-care-for leather.”
Step 4: Include a Call to Action
- Prompt: “End the product description with a strong call to action that encourages customers to purchase the backpack. Use persuasive language to create a sense of urgency, such as ‘Upgrade your daily carry with our premium leather backpack—order now and enjoy free shipping!'”
This advanced prompt sequence ensures that the product description is not only informative but also persuasive, addressing customer concerns and encouraging conversions.
Leveraging Nested Prompts for Website Development
Website development involves numerous interconnected elements, from layout and design to functionality and performance optimization. Nested prompts can help you manage these complexities by guiding ChatGPT through each step of the development process.
Example 1: Nested Prompts for Creating a Responsive Layout
Creating a responsive layout is essential for ensuring your website looks great on all devices. Here’s how to use nested prompts to develop a responsive layout using HTML and CSS.
Step 1: Define the Layout Structure
- Prompt: “Generate HTML code for a basic webpage layout with a header, a navigation bar, a main content area, and a footer. The navigation bar should include links to ‘Home,’ ‘About Us,’ ‘Services,’ and ‘Contact.’ The main content area should have three columns.”
Step 2: Make the Layout Responsive
- Prompt: “Modify the HTML code to include CSS that makes the layout responsive. The navigation bar should collapse into a hamburger menu on mobile devices, and the three columns in the main content area should stack vertically on smaller screens.”
Step 3: Optimize for Performance
- Prompt: “Optimize the CSS code to improve load times. Use techniques such as minifying the CSS, reducing HTTP requests, and optimizing images for the web. Provide examples of these optimizations in the code.”
Step 4: Test for Accessibility
- Prompt: “Add ARIA roles and labels to the HTML code to improve accessibility. Ensure that the navigation menu is fully accessible using a keyboard and that screen readers can navigate the page effectively.”
This nested prompt sequence guides ChatGPT through the entire process of creating a responsive and accessible layout, ensuring that the final code is both functional and user-friendly.
Example 2: Nested Prompts for Building a Dynamic Image Gallery
An image gallery is a common feature on many websites, especially portfolios and e-commerce sites. Here’s how to use nested prompts to build a dynamic image gallery using JavaScript.
Step 1: Create the HTML Structure
- Prompt: “Generate HTML code for an image gallery with six images displayed in a grid layout. Each image should have a caption underneath it.”
Step 2: Add CSS for Styling
- Prompt: “Write CSS code to style the image gallery. The images should be displayed in two rows of three, with equal spacing between them. The captions should be centered and have a subtle shadow effect.”
Step 3: Implement JavaScript for Dynamic Functionality
- Prompt: “Add JavaScript code to make the image gallery dynamic. When a user clicks on an image, it should open in a lightbox overlay with next/previous navigation buttons. Include a close button to exit the lightbox view.”
Step 4: Optimize for Mobile Devices
- Prompt: “Modify the JavaScript and CSS code to ensure the image gallery is fully functional on mobile devices. The images should display in a single column on small screens, and the lightbox should be touch-friendly with swipe navigation.”
This sequence of nested prompts allows you to build a sophisticated image gallery that is both visually appealing and functional across different devices.
Advanced SEO Techniques Using ChatGPT Prompts
Search engine optimization (SEO) is critical for driving organic traffic to your website. Advanced ChatGPT prompts can help you implement effective SEO strategies that improve your site’s visibility in search engine results.
Example 1: Advanced Keyword Optimization
Optimizing your website’s content for specific keywords is essential for improving its search engine ranking. Here’s how to use advanced prompts to optimize content for SEO.
Step 1: Identify Target Keywords
- Prompt: “Identify the top five keywords for a blog post about sustainable fashion. The target audience is environmentally conscious consumers who are interested in eco-friendly clothing.”
Step 2: Optimize Existing Content
- Prompt: “Rewrite the following paragraph to include the identified keywords naturally: ‘Sustainable fashion is gaining popularity as more people seek environmentally friendly alternatives to fast fashion. Eco-conscious consumers are looking for brands that prioritize ethical production practices and use sustainable materials.'”
Step 3: Create SEO-Friendly Meta Tags
- Prompt: “Generate a title tag and meta description for the blog post that includes the identified keywords. The title tag should be under 60 characters, and the meta description should be under 160 characters.”
Step 4: Implement Internal Linking
- Prompt: “Suggest internal links to other relevant blog posts or pages on the website that would enhance the SEO value of this blog post. Provide anchor text for each link that includes one of the target keywords.”
By using advanced prompts, you can ensure that your content is fully optimized for SEO, helping it rank higher in search engine results and attract more organic traffic.
Example 2: Structured Data Implementation
Structured data, also known as schema markup, helps search engines understand the content on your website and can improve your visibility in search results. Here’s how to use advanced prompts to implement structured data on your website.
Step 1: Define the Content Type
- Prompt: “I want to add structured data to a product page for an online store. The product is an organic cotton t-shirt. The structured data should include information about the product name, price, availability, and customer reviews.”
Step 2: Generate JSON-LD Structured Data
- Prompt: “Generate JSON-LD structured data for the product page, including the product name, price, availability, SKU, and an aggregate rating based on customer reviews. Ensure the structured data follows Google’s guidelines for e-commerce websites.”
Step 3: Test and Validate the Structured Data
- Prompt: “Provide instructions on how to test and validate the structured data using Google’s Structured Data Testing Tool. Include any common errors to watch out for and how to fix them.”
Step 4: Optimize for Rich Snippets
- Prompt: “Suggest additional structured data elements that could be added to enhance the likelihood of the product page appearing as a rich snippet in search results. Consider adding data for product images, related products, and offers.”
This advanced approach to structured data implementation ensures that your product pages are optimized for better visibility and engagement in search results, potentially leading to higher click-through rates.
Combining Advanced Prompts with ChatGPT for Design and User Experience
Design and user experience (UX) are critical components of a successful website. Advanced and nested prompts can help you create a visually appealing and user-friendly website that meets the needs of your audience.
Example 1: Advanced Design Elements
Design elements like typography, color schemes, and layout are crucial for creating a cohesive and professional website. Here’s how to use advanced prompts to guide ChatGPT in generating design ideas.
Step 1: Define the Visual Identity
- Prompt: “Describe a color scheme and typography selection for a website focused on wellness and mindfulness. The website should evoke feelings of calm and tranquility, using a soft, pastel color palette and modern, sans-serif fonts.”
Step 2: Suggest Layout Ideas
- Prompt: “Suggest three layout ideas for the homepage of the wellness website. Each layout should include a hero image, an introduction section, a list of services, and testimonials from clients. One layout should be minimalistic, one should be image-centric, and one should be text-focused.”
Step 3: Create Interactive Elements
- Prompt: “Generate ideas for interactive elements that can be added to the wellness website to enhance user engagement. Consider adding features like a meditation timer, a mood tracker, and a guided breathing exercise.”
Step 4: Optimize for Accessibility
- Prompt: “Provide guidelines for making the website’s design accessible to users with disabilities. Include tips for color contrast, font size, alt text for images, and keyboard navigation.”
By using advanced prompts, you can ensure that your website’s design is not only visually appealing but also functional, engaging, and accessible to all users.
Example 2: Enhancing User Experience (UX)
User experience is a key factor in determining how visitors interact with your website. Here’s how to use advanced prompts to optimize the UX of your site.
Step 1: Analyze User Behavior
- Prompt: “Based on heatmap data showing that users frequently abandon the contact form, suggest potential UX improvements that could reduce drop-off rates. Consider changes to form length, layout, and field labels.”
Step 2: Simplify Navigation
- Prompt: “Provide recommendations for simplifying the website’s navigation. The site currently has a complex menu structure with multiple subcategories. Suggest ways to streamline the navigation while ensuring all important sections are easily accessible.”
Step 3: Improve Mobile Usability
- Prompt: “Identify common mobile usability issues and suggest improvements for the website’s mobile version. Focus on touch-friendly design, load times, and readability on smaller screens.”
Step 4: Personalize User Experience
- Prompt: “Generate ideas for personalizing the user experience based on visitor behavior. For example, suggest how the website could recommend content, products, or services based on previous interactions or preferences.”
By using advanced prompts to optimize UX, you can create a website that is intuitive, easy to navigate, and provides a positive experience for all users, leading to higher engagement and satisfaction.
Advanced Nested Prompts for Website Maintenance and Optimization
Website maintenance and optimization are ongoing processes that ensure your website remains secure, up-to-date, and performs well. Nested prompts can help you manage these tasks efficiently.
Example 1: Nested Prompts for Performance Optimization
Website performance is critical for user experience and SEO. Here’s how to use nested prompts to optimize your website’s performance.
Step 1: Analyze Current Performance
- Prompt: “Provide a detailed analysis of the website’s current performance metrics, including page load times, server response times, and resource usage. Identify any areas where performance is below industry standards.”
Step 2: Optimize Code and Assets
- Prompt: “Suggest code optimizations to improve page load times. Consider techniques such as minifying CSS and JavaScript, leveraging browser caching, and optimizing images. Provide examples of how to implement these optimizations.”
Step 3: Implement Caching Strategies
- Prompt: “Recommend caching strategies to reduce server load and improve page load times. Explain the difference between server-side caching and client-side caching, and suggest which one would be more effective for this website.”
Step 4: Monitor Performance Over Time
- Prompt: “Develop a monitoring plan to track the website’s performance over time. Suggest tools and metrics to monitor, and provide guidelines for responding to performance issues as they arise.”
This nested prompt sequence helps you systematically optimize your website’s performance, ensuring fast load times and a smooth user experience.
Example 2: Nested Prompts for Security and Maintenance
Website security is essential for protecting your site and users from threats. Here’s how to use nested prompts to manage website security and maintenance tasks.
Step 1: Conduct a Security Audit
- Prompt: “Conduct a security audit of the website and identify potential vulnerabilities. Focus on areas such as user authentication, data encryption, and server security. Provide recommendations for addressing any identified issues.”
Step 2: Implement Security Best Practices
- Prompt: “Provide a list of security best practices to implement on the website. Include recommendations for password policies, two-factor authentication, SSL certificates, and regular security updates.”
Step 3: Schedule Regular Maintenance
- Prompt: “Create a maintenance schedule for the website, including tasks such as software updates, backup procedures, and security scans. Suggest tools or services that can automate these tasks.”
Step 4: Prepare for Incident Response
- Prompt: “Develop an incident response plan for the website in case of a security breach. Include steps for identifying and containing the breach, notifying affected users, and restoring the website to normal operation.”
By using nested prompts to manage website security and maintenance, you can ensure that your site remains secure, up-to-date, and resilient against potential threats.
Conclusion: Mastering Advanced ChatGPT Prompts and Nested Prompts for Website Building
Using advanced and nested prompts with ChatGPT allows you to unlock the full potential of AI in website building. These techniques enable you to generate highly targeted and sophisticated content, streamline your development process, optimize your site for performance and security, and enhance user experience.
By following the strategies and examples provided in this guide, you can harness the power of ChatGPT to create a website that is not only visually appealing and user-friendly but also optimized for success in the competitive digital landscape. Whether you’re building a new website from scratch or optimizing an existing one, advanced and nested prompts can help you achieve your goals more efficiently and effectively.
As you continue to use ChatGPT, remember that the key to success lies in crafting clear, specific, and detailed prompts. With practice and experimentation, you’ll become adept at using advanced and nested prompts to tackle even the most complex website-building tasks, ultimately creating a polished, professional, and high-performing online presence.